Fleming County, Kentucky Electricity Overview
Residents in Fleming County experience an average of 1.05 outages lasting 127.06 minutes per year, compared to the US averages of 1.44 outages at 123.49 minutes an outage.
By megawatt hours sold, the largest electricity supplier in Fleming County is Fleming Mason Energy.
Fleming County is the 70th highest pollution level from electricity consumption in Kentucky, releasing 196,702,371.45 kilograms of CO2 gases.
Residents in Fleming County pay $151.51 per month for residential electricity, compared to the Kentucky average of $144.81.
With a population of 14,996 residents, Fleming County is the 2166th most populated county in the United States.
The electricity consumed by consumers in Fleming County is produced outside of their borders as the county has no power generation facilities.

Flemingsburg, KY Electricity Overview

Flemingsburg averages a residential electricity rate of 12.52 cents per kilowatt hour, which is 4.00% less than the state's average price of 13.04 cents. The electricity grid in the city has an average of 1.05 outages per consumer a year, with outages lasting roughly 127.06 minutes each. The countrywide averages of outages and outage time frames are 1.44 outages each year and 123.49 minutes per outage. The US average monthly residential electric bill is $146.54, while the Flemingsburg average is 6.05% lower at $137.68 per month.
On average, Flemingsburg citizens emit 13,116.99 kilograms of CO2 emissions from electricity usage, which makes it the 160th highest polluting city out of 556 cities in the state. This adds up to total emissions of 38,013,034.97 kilograms of CO2 emissions, ranking the city 122nd highest for total pollution in the state. All of the electricity consumed in Flemingsburg has to be brought in from neighboring cities or rural areas, because there are no power generation sources in the city.

FAQ
What electricity company is the largest provider in Fleming County, Kentucky?
The largest electricity company in Fleming County, Kentucky by total customer count is Fleming Mason Energy.
How many electric companies offer service in Fleming County, Kentucky?
There are 2 electricity companies offering service in Fleming County, Kentucky.
What electricity companies offer service in Fleming County, Kentucky?
County Customers Rank | Provider | Est. County Customers |
---|---|---|
1 | Fleming Mason Energy | 5,941 |
2 | Kentucky Utilities | 1,567 |
